Karley Lane was married at 19. Over the next 10 years she experienced becoming a mother, being a stay at home mom, divorce, working full time, remarriage, and the traumatic birth of her second child. At 29 years old, and excited about her 30’s, Karley’s reflection of her past, and anticipation about the future fosters a unique perspective on all that it means to be a woman, spouse, mother and professional navigating life today.
